Special Song

by hedwig (Age: 21)
copyright 11-10-2005


Age Rating: 1 +

All alone, eyes closed, singing your heart out.
Fingertips brushing against your right cheek.
Slowly tilting your head left to right.
The lyrics getting you teary eyed.
Relating to the words.
The slow piano touching your soul.
Amy Lee's voice filling your heart.
Hours being wasted, but you assume it's only been a minute.
Your fingertips find themselves sliding against the nearest surface.
You feel as beautiful as the song.
You want everyone to feel this way.
This is how I feel when I listen to Evanescence.
